ABSTRACT
The operational embrittlement based on the determination of the impact toughness KCV of longitudinal and transverse to the rolling direction specimens of API 5L X67 steel of the reserve pipes and operated for 34 years on the gas main pipeline was investigated. The influence of different orientations of the notch in the specimens relative to the rolling direction and the pipe axis was analyzed and a significant influence of this factor on the impact toughness was revealed, which is generally higher for specimens with a notch oriented in the short transversal direction. The sensitivity of KCV to operational degradation was the highest for tests of transverse specimens with a concentrator in the axial direction. Using macrofractographic analysis, a typical low-energy delamination along the rolling direction was observed.
